On Friday July27th, 2018 Carl Onora Ikeme the Wolverhampton Wanderers and theSuper Eagles of Nigeria goalkeeper, announced his retirement from footballafter a successful recovery from Acute leukemia treatment and theraphy.
The decisionwhich was a difficult one for the 32-year old Nigerian came after the doctorsadviced him to take the bold step that bring an end to an eventful footballcareer.
It is always achallenging period in a footballer’s career to retire prematurely to healthconcerns, but in this article we outline how the world rallied round Ikemewhich reinforced the value of humanity in the passionate round leather game.
Carl Ikeme had10 national team caps for Nigeria and played 200 games for WolverhamptonWanderers F.C club in England.
One Carl Ikeme Tribute
It was verytouching to see a short video clip that featured top class veteran and currentgoalkeepers across the globe, pay tribute to Carl Ikeme with the “One CarlIkeme” phrase.
From PetrSchmeichel(Retired Danish Goalkeeper), David Seaman (Retired English Keeper) toLukas Fabianski(Polish Keeper), Iker Casillas (Spanish Keeper), Joe Hart(English Keeper,), Mac Andre Ter Stegen (German Keeper) and Petr Cech(Czech Keeper), it was a show of solidarity to their fellow goalkeeper.
Tribute from Super Eagles Players
From FellowSuper Eagles Players like Ahmed Musa, Ogenyi Onazi, John Ogu, Daniel Akpeyi andKenneth Omeruo, it was all praises and commendations for Carl Ikeme as agoalkeeper, teammate and friend.
They sent theirbest wishes to him, praying for his progress in future endeavours.
NFF Offer
In recognitionof his contributions to the national football team, the Nigerian FootballFederation has offered Carl Ikeme a role in its technical crew, which if heagrees to will come after series of coaching courses.
This is awelcome development to how Nigeria treats its sports athletes who have to endtheir careers abruptly to injuries or special ailments.
Carl Ikemethroughout his treatment received massive encouragement and support from theNFF.
